Output 53dec2927ca159645121fb88f847d6039e959cad3f407baf85d859d36a809a5e:5

value
314584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17d397f32ec83edd2709182af2cb64603881f19 OP_EQUAL
address
3HsVYFm2NiyyuYfmYyWVgzc5T8Hg6NPwZD
transaction
53dec2927ca159645121fb88f847d6039e959cad3f407baf85d859d36a809a5e
spent
true